当前位置: 首页 > news >正文

联想E14装Ubuntu18.04没WiFi?手把手教你搞定Realtek RTL8111/8168/8411网卡驱动

联想E14安装Ubuntu 18.04后WiFi消失的终极解决方案

当你满怀期待地在联想E14笔记本上安装好Ubuntu 18.04,准备开始Linux之旅时,却发现右上角的WiFi图标神秘消失了——这可能是Realtek RTL8111/8168/8411系列网卡驱动不兼容导致的经典问题。作为一名经历过多次Linux硬件兼容性挑战的老手,我将带你一步步排查并彻底解决这个恼人的问题。

1. 问题诊断与准备工作

在开始修复之前,我们需要确认几个关键信息。首先打开终端(Ctrl+Alt+T),输入以下命令检查网卡型号:

lspci -nnk | grep -iA3 net

你应该会看到类似这样的输出:

03:00.0 Network controller [0280]: Realtek Semiconductor Co., Ltd. RTL8111/8168/8411 PCI Express Gigabit Ethernet Controller [10ec:8168] (rev 15)

注意:如果你的输出中没有显示Realtek相关型号,可能需要考虑其他解决方案。

临时联网方案

  • 使用USB转以太网适配器连接有线网络
  • 通过USB线共享手机网络(Android用户可启用USB网络共享)
  • 如果有另一台电脑,可以下载所需驱动文件并通过U盘传输

2. 获取正确的驱动版本

经过多次实践验证,Realtek RTL8111/8168/8411系列网卡在Ubuntu 18.04上最稳定的驱动版本是r8168-8.046.00。以下是获取驱动的几种可靠途径:

来源优点缺点
Realtek官方FTP版本齐全下载速度较慢
GitHub镜像仓库社区维护可能需要搜索
Linux内核官网稳定可靠版本可能较旧

推荐使用以下命令直接从终端下载(需临时联网):

wget https://mirrors.edge.kernel.org/pub/linux/kernel/people/firmware/realtek/r8168-8.046.00.tar.bz2

如果下载链接失效,可以尝试在GitHub搜索"r8168 driver",选择星标较高的仓库获取。

3. 驱动编译与安装详细流程

下载完成后,按照以下步骤操作:

  1. 解压驱动包:
tar -xjvf r8168-8.046.00.tar.bz2
  1. 进入解压后的目录:
cd r8168-8.046.00
  1. 编译前的环境检查:
sudo apt update sudo apt install build-essential linux-headers-$(uname -r)
  1. 编译并安装驱动:
make clean make sudo make install

常见问题处理

  • 如果遇到"make: *** /lib/modules/.../build: No such file or directory"错误,说明缺少内核头文件,需执行:
sudo apt install linux-headers-generic

4. 驱动加载与系统配置

安装完成后,需要手动加载新驱动并确保系统正确识别:

sudo modprobe r8168

验证驱动是否加载成功:

lsmod | grep r8168 dmesg | grep r8168

为了确保系统启动时自动加载正确驱动,建议禁用可能导致冲突的内核自带驱动:

echo "blacklist r8169" | sudo tee /etc/modprobe.d/blacklist-r8169.conf sudo update-initramfs -u

最后重启系统:

sudo reboot

5. 验证与故障排除

重启后,按照以下步骤验证WiFi功能:

  1. 检查网络图标是否重新出现
  2. 点击图标查看可用的无线网络
  3. 尝试连接已知可用的WiFi网络

如果问题依旧,可以尝试以下排查步骤:

  • 检查硬件开关:有些笔记本有物理WiFi开关
  • 查看rfkill状态:
rfkill list

如果显示被hard blocked,可能需要按Fn+Fx组合键启用无线功能

  • 检查NetworkManager服务状态:
systemctl status NetworkManager

6. 长期维护与升级建议

为了保持网卡驱动的稳定性和兼容性,建议:

  1. 定期检查驱动更新:
sudo apt search r8168
  1. 升级到更新的Ubuntu LTS版本(如20.04或22.04),这些版本通常有更好的硬件支持

  2. 创建系统快照以便回滚:

sudo apt install timeshift timeshift --create

在实际使用中,我发现Realtek网卡在Linux下的表现会随着内核更新而改善。如果遇到连接不稳定问题,可以尝试调整MTU值:

sudo ip link set dev wlp3s0 mtu 1500

小技巧:将上述命令添加到/etc/rc.local文件中可实现开机自动设置

经过这些步骤,你的联想E14应该已经恢复了完整的无线网络功能。我在多台同型号笔记本上测试过这个方案,成功率接近100%。如果遇到特殊情况,建议查阅Linux社区的最新讨论或Realtek官方文档获取针对性解决方案。

http://www.gsyq.cn/news/1399746.html

相关文章:

  • 一线记者做采访录音,会议纪要整理使用场景实用指南
  • 老芯片新玩法:用XL1509 Buck转换器给树莓派DIY一个12V转5V的稳定电源模块
  • 会议录音整理太慢写不完?整理会议录音推荐这样选
  • OpenClaw版本兼容问题:旧版本技能在新版本中无法使用的适配技巧
  • LabelImg安装后打不开?5种常见报错排查与修复指南(Windows/Mac通用)
  • LLM如何提升Terraform IaC开发效率:实战场景与协同策略
  • QUASAR:基于基础模型的零样本图像质量与美学评估框架
  • 从架构设计根治文档处理管道背压:反应式流与弹性伸缩实战
  • Lovable新功能上线倒计时:7大高价值特性详解及迁移避坑清单
  • 车载OTA升级失败率超19%?:Lovable边缘协同升级框架揭秘——从断网续传到签名验签零信任加固全流程
  • Claude提示词工程实战:从120条“秘密代码”中验证有效技巧与避坑指南
  • 自定义 ROS 2 机器人部署至 Gazebo Ionic 仿真环境(第一部分):ros_gz_bridge 消息桥接与多机器人管理
  • 别再死记硬背N-Gram了!用Python从零实现一个能‘打分’的句子生成器
  • 你的GEO优化,还是从关键词开始的吗?那你从一开始就错了
  • C++ auto
  • 应用落地与硬核实力|云克隆猫原代细胞高品质助力科研、兽药、临床全场景
  • 2026效果好服务优GEO服务商甄选:口碑佳值得合作机构测评
  • 2026年阿拉善左旗哪些电器门店老板人好?这份名单请查收
  • ROS 2 Lyrical Luth启程-Ubuntu26.04-
  • 量子计算加持:AI Agent的算力革命何时到来?
  • 2026年合肥GEO品牌优选指南,哪家更值得信赖?
  • 从Stackdriver到Google Cloud运维套件:一站式可观测性平台深度解析
  • 警惕Agent框架的“驯化”风险:从工具使用者到系统架构师的思维转变
  • 云克隆抗体:科研与诊断领域的可靠伙伴
  • Kafka分区策略深度解析
  • 回收RS罗德与施瓦茨 RTP134B示波器
  • 本地AI助手实战:基于Whisper与LLM的语音控制智能体开发
  • 销售拜访录音怎么整理成客户跟进记录?4款热门转写工具实测盘点
  • AI智能体记忆存储实战:SQLite+FTS5方案对比向量数据库
  • 乐迪信息:船舶违规停靠AI自动识别,港口管理更规范